Beans and cereals are healthy, right? Well, not if you are following the Paleo diet. This dietary regimen is based on the diet of ancient, nomadic men of the Paleolithic Era. The diet of the Paleolithic people, also called Stone Age men or cavemen, consists mainly of food hunted and gathered in the wild. This makes the diet very selective indeed, and it can be tricky to stick to it. To make your caveman diet journey simpler, here is a list of Paleo foods to avoid.

According to the caveman diet, foods prepared and produced outside the Paleolithic Era are not well-adapted to the human body, causing diseases of civilization or lifestyle diseases. This means that farm produce are not allowed in the caveman diet. More specifically, the foods to avoid in a caveman diet plan are:

1. Legumes – All kinds of beans such as black beans, garbanzo beans, kidney beans, mung beans, string beans and lima beans have to be eliminated. Black-eyed peas, chickpeas, lentils, snow peas, sugar snap peas, peanuts, soybeans and soybean products are also excluded.

2. Dairy products – All kinds of dairy foods like butter, cheese, cream, yogurt, ice cream, low-fat milk, skim milk, whole milk, dairy creamer, and all processed foods that contain dairy must be avoided.

3. Cereals or grains – All forms of cereal grains such as barley, corn, millet, oats, rice, rye, sorghum, wheat, wild rice, and all foods made of cereal products are to be avoided.

4. Grain-like seeds – Amaranth, buckwheat and quinoa are excluded in Paleolithic diet recipes.

Factory farmed meats – Certain parts of conventionally raised chicken and turkey (skin, legs, wings and thighs), fatty beef roasts and ribs, fatty pork chops, ribs and roasts, lamb chops, leg and roasts, pork sausage, and T-bone steak are to be avoided in the Paleo diet plan. The fats on animals who were fed pesticide-laden grains aren’t favorable. Opt for grass-fed, pasture-raised animal products.

8. Soft drinks and fruit juices – All types of sugary soft drinks and all types of fruit juices canned, bottled and even freshly squeezed fruit juices (lack the fiber) are not allowed.

9. Sweets – Sugar is excluded. Raw honey and coconut sap are acceptable sometimes.
